Multi-step reaction with 4 steps
1: tetrahydrofuran / 4 h / 0 °C
2: 4-methylmorpholine N-oxide; osmium(VIII) oxide / acetone; water; toluene / 3 h / 0 °C
3: tin (IV) chloride pentahydrate / dichloromethane / 0.5 h / 0 °C
4: platinum(IV) oxide; hydrogen / methanol / 2 h / 1551.49 Torr
With
platinum(IV) oxide; osmium(VIII) oxide; tin (IV) chloride pentahydrate; hydrogen; 4-methylmorpholine N-oxide;
In
tetrahydrofuran; methanol; dichloromethane; water; acetone; toluene;
1: |Wittig Olefination;
DOI:10.1016/j.tetlet.2016.12.083

Multi-step reaction with 10 steps
1.1: potassium carbonate / acetone / 15 h / 56 °C / Inert atmosphere
2.1: AD-mix-β; methanesulfonamide / tert-butyl alcohol; water / 12 h / 20 °C
3.1: boron trifluoride diethyl etherate / acetone / 2 h
4.1: lithium aluminium tetrahydride / tetrahydrofuran / 1 h / 0 °C
5.1: oxalyl dichloride; dimethyl sulfoxide / dichloromethane / 2 h / -78 °C / Inert atmosphere
5.2: 0.33 h / -78 - 20 °C / Inert atmosphere
6.1: tetrahydrofuran / 4 h / 0 °C
7.1: 4-methylmorpholine N-oxide; osmium(VIII) oxide / acetone; water; toluene / 3 h / 0 °C
8.1: scandium tris(trifluoromethanesulfonate) / dichloromethane / 0.5 h / 0 °C
9.1: hydrogenchloride / water; methanol / 0.5 h / 0 °C
10.1: platinum(IV) oxide; hydrogen / methanol / 2 h / 1551.49 Torr
With
hydrogenchloride; platinum(IV) oxide; osmium(VIII) oxide; lithium aluminium tetrahydride; oxalyl dichloride; methanesulfonamide; boron trifluoride diethyl etherate; AD-mix-β; hydrogen; potassium carbonate; dimethyl sulfoxide; 4-methylmorpholine N-oxide; scandium tris(trifluoromethanesulfonate);
In
tetrahydrofuran; methanol; dichloromethane; water; acetone; toluene; tert-butyl alcohol;
5.1: |Swern Oxidation / 5.2: |Swern Oxidation / 6.1: |Wittig Olefination;
DOI:10.1016/j.tetlet.2016.12.083
